Jump to content

dev botao

Access Violation em BPL ao abrir o Delphi após instalar o ACBr


EMBarbosa
  • Este tópico foi criado há 1302 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Consultores

Pode acontecer de acontecer um erro de Access Violation (AV) ao abrir o Delphi após instalar o ACBr como na imagem abaixo:

unknown.png

Esse erro se dá quando o Delphi carrega uma BPL do ACBr mas encontra uma outra versão da BPL que ela depende.

Pode acontecer por exemplo quando você instala algum componente no Delphi diretamente por meio do pacote e depois executa o processo de instalação usando o ACBrInstall.

Solução:

Para corrigir o problema basta excluir as BPLs duplicadas. Geralmente elas estão no caminho padrão de BPLs do Delphi.

Exemplo:

Por exemplo assumindo o Windows 10 e versões do Delphi mais recente esse caminho seria:

C:\Users\Public\Documents\Embarcadero\Studio\NN.N\Bpl
Onde o NN.N é uma versão do Delphi

Por exemplo, no erro que aconteceu da imagem acima haviam BPLs do ACBr na seguinte pasta:
C:\Users\Public\Documents\Embarcadero\Studio\20.0\Bpl

Removendo essas BPLs o Delphi volta a funcionar corretamente.

  • Like 1

[]'s

Consultor SAC ACBr

Elton
Profissionalize o ACBr na sua empresa, conheça o ACBr Pro.

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Um engenheiro de Controle de Qualidade(QA) entra num bar. Pede uma cerveja. Pede zero cervejas.
Pede 99999999 cervejas. Pede -1 cervejas. Pede um jacaré. Pede asdfdhklçkh.
Link to comment
Share on other sites

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.

The popup will be closed in 10 seconds...